Description
The Fraternity is undoubtedly the essential characteristic of Freemasonry.
Now, this fraternal bond begins in the history of humanity with a fratricide, the murder of Abel by his brother Cain.
This relationship between brothers has therefore not ceased to reveal itself, throughout the Bible, very often paradoxical, because source of rivalries and conflicts fuelled by jealousy and misunderstanding.
Why is the Masonic Brotherhood so special, since it is not based on a blood bond?
What singular form does it take, what is its most accomplished expression?
Laurent Toubol, specialist in Freemasonry, is National Grand Preceptor of the Ancient and Accepted Scottish Rite and Venerable Master of the National Training Lodge “Hiram” of the Grande Loge Nationale Française.
